does that mean your best rebounder should be at center or excel, or you switch the lesser to pf to make 2 equal rebounders?     
Not necessarily, in fact, I think it depends more on speed imo. I would put my 60/40/90 ath/spd/reb at PF and my 80/20/70 ath/spd/reb at Center. I think speed in really valuable at the 4... At the 5 too and obviously 1-3, but my choice between the 4 and 5 would almost always be the 4. I wouldn't even check their REB abilities when making my decision, but that's just me.
